Onion (Allium Ascalonicum L) are one of the leading horticultural commodities that have economic value. In cultivation, Fusarium wilt disease is often damaged caused by the fungus Fusarium oxysporum. This study aimed to examine the effect of biofertilizer application on fusarium wilt disease, growth and yield of onion. The treatments tested were Bion-up biofertilizer, KIBRT, Biostimulant, Azoto-Tricho, anthracol fungicide, and without biological fertilizer as a control. Using a randomized block design with three replications. Observation variables were the incidence of fusarium wilt disease, plant height, number and weight of tubers. The results showed that the application of biofertilizers (Bion up, KIBRT, Biostimulants and Azoto-Tricho) was effective in increasing plant height, number of bulbs, and bulb weight of onion bulbs, while controlling the development of fusarium wilt disease was more effective when using Bion up, KIBRT, and Azoto-Tricho.Keywords: Biofertilizer, Antracol, Shallots, Fusarium oxysporum
